Key Technical Trends Shaping Next-Generation Network Switches

To successfully navigate the high-speed networking segment, it is critical to trace the underlying physical and architectural protocols driving hardware development. Below are the key engineering vectors defining current and future switch generations:

RoCE v2 vs. InfiniBand

Modern deep learning platforms require high-throughput, low-latency links. RDMA over Converged Ethernet (RoCE v2) has emerged as a major alternative to proprietary InfiniBand architectures. It enables standard Ethernet switches to bypass CPU intervention for direct memory-to-memory data transfers, delivering ultra-low-latency transport layers that are cost-effective to scale.

Non-Blocking Switching Fabrics

Modern spine-and-leaf architectures rely heavily on non-blocking ASICs. These ensure that packet routes across the switch matrix do not suffer from internal link congestion. With data transmission rates hitting 51.2 Tbps per single ASIC, maintaining deterministic latency profiles (under 500ns) has become a primary target for hardware developers.

Co-Packaged Optics (CPO)

As speeds shift from 400G and 800G toward 1.6T, electrical signals face steep degradation over copper tracks. Co-Packaged Optics (CPO) integration embeds optical engines directly onto the same organic substrate as the main ASIC. This reduces trace loss, power draw, and physical layout constraints.

Localized Application Scenarios

High-speed switches require tailoring to the distinct physical realities and environmental configurations where they are deployed. CloudionAI builds platforms engineered to resolve localized performance challenges:

Industrial Smart Factories

Industrial settings expose network devices to high dust, vibration, and EMI. Localized deployments demand ruggedized fanless switches with extended operating temperatures (-40°C to 75°C) and DIN-rail mounting. These switches ensure real-time TSN (Time-Sensitive Networking) communications on the factory floor, preventing packet loss in robotic control and vision-based QA loops.

Financial Trading Desks

In algorithmic and high-frequency trading (HFT), latency is measured in nanoseconds. Localized hardware setups feature sub-100ns port-to-port cut-through switching. Integrating custom FPGA modules directly into the switch interface allows financial institutions to handle massive, simultaneous transaction queues without introducing queue delay bottlenecks.

Edge Compute Nodes

Deployments in smart city grids, telecom microstations, and automated transportation hubs require compact footprint hardware. Half-width 1U or 2U switch-server combinations optimize limited rack space while providing high thermal tolerances, lowering maintenance overheads in unmanned locations.

Technology Roadmap & Future Outlook

High-speed networking is progressing along a clear trajectory focused on bandwidth scaling, automated fabric configuration, and environmental sustainability. By anticipating these shifts, CloudionAI remains aligned with future enterprise needs:

1.6T Ethernet & Beyond

With 112G and 224G SerDes technologies maturing, the industry is transitioning to 1.6T physical architectures, doubling current 800G capabilities to handle next-generation workloads.

Intelligent Telemetry

In-band Network Telemetry (INT) monitors packet flows at line rate. This telemetry provides real-time insights into congestion, microbursts, and path histories without degrading forwarding performance.

Liquid-Cooled Switching

Modern ASICs run hot, and traditional air cooling is reaching its physical limits. Designing direct-to-chip liquid cooling manifolds for switches ensures operational reliability at peak compute loads.

Automated SDN Fabrics

Intent-Based Networking (IBN) uses machine learning to automatically configure policies and optimize routing paths. This automation helps prevent congestion before it impacts end-user performance.

What is the advantage of using RoCE v2 over standard TCP/IP networking?
RoCE v2 (RDMA over Converged Ethernet) encapsulates Remote Direct Memory Access packets in standard UDP frames, allowing direct memory transfers between servers without involving operating system software stacks. In contrast to traditional TCP/IP networks—which incur significant latency and CPU overhead due to kernel interventions—RoCE v2 achieves sub-microsecond latencies and frees server CPU resources for calculations. This makes it an ideal transport layer for GPU-intensive AI clusters.

What role do non-blocking switching fabrics play in avoiding network congestion?
A non-blocking switching fabric guarantees that any input port can forward data to any output port at full wire speed without internal blocking. In high-density environments where multi-gigabit data streams converge, blocking architectures can cause buffer overflows and packet drops. How does EVPN-VXLAN support multi-tenant virtualization?
EVPN-VXLAN uses Ethernet VPN (EVPN) as a control plane to route Virtual Extensible LAN (VXLAN) overlays. This architecture decouples virtual networks from physical hardware, allowing operators to scale up to 16 million virtual networks. It also optimizes traffic routing and simplifies management across large cloud data centers.
